Jaquan Brown, 24, Arrested For Shooting Death Of 35-Year-Old Donelle Hunter

POMPANO BEACH, FL (Boca Post) (Copyright © 2023) — 24-year-old Jaquan Brown has been charged with murder for the shooting death of a Pompano Beach man in July.

The detectives from the Violence Intervention Proactive Enforcement Response (V.I.P.E.R.) unit of the Broward Sheriff’s Office apprehended Jaquan Brown on Monday afternoon as a suspect in the murder of Donelle Hunter. The shooting, as reported by Boca Post,  took place in Pompano Beach back in July

According to investigators from the BSO Homicide Unit, a call was received by Broward County Regional Communications around 6;20 p.m. On Saturday, July 1st, reporting a shooting incident near Northwest 17th Terrace and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Boulevard in Pompano Beach. Deputies from BSO and Pompano Beach Fire Rescue promptly responded to the scene where they found Hunter with a gunshot wound. He was immediately transported to Broward Health North where he was later pronounced dead.

On Friday, October 13th, detectives obtained an arrest warrant for Brown on charges of first degree murder. Following his apprehension on Monday for murder and violation of probation, Brown was taken to the Broward Main Jail.
